In a poignant journey of healing, actress Bimbo Oshin has gracefully stepped back into limelight, shedding the toga of bereavement two years after the heartbreaking demise of her beloved husband, Dudu Heritage.

Dudu Heritage, a prominent figure in both the social and entertainment spheres, succumbed to a heart attack in 2021 at the Ibadan Golf Club.

Oshin, known for her exceptional talent, took a self-imposed hiatus from social activities and even social media, giving herself the necessary time to mourn and reflect on the profound loss.

Her disappearance from the public glare spoke volumes about the depth of her grief and the enduring impact of her husband’s presence in her life.

However, recent developments in the life of this delectable actress signal a beautiful resurgence.

It is evident that Bimbo Oshin has found strength and courage to embrace a new chapter, marked by joy and social connections.

The actress, radiating positivity, was joyously spotted at the 50th birthday celebration of Princess Abólanle Bada, surrounded by friends and colleagues who share in her happiness.
